Address 0 PPC

PPZaqjncKfCQEXGMMkLxvuyfe37EYhzQmf

Confirmed

Total Received1197.300597 PPC
Total Sent1197.300597 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PZaqjncKfCQEXGMMkLxvuyfe37EYhzQmf1197.300597 PPC
Fee: 0.01 PPC
710983 Confirmations1197.290597 PPC
PPZaqjncKfCQEXGMMkLxvuyfe37EYhzQmf1197.300597 PPC
PGyGXjDTS9PpdCPEf7XfCG9XPWg5ToHmHZ27.546328 PPC
Fee: 0.01 PPC
711013 Confirmations1224.846925 PPC